Job Search Place Limited is looking for a VP - Global Payments Project Product Controller in London. The successful candidate will lead strategic finance initiatives and ensure effective project delivery in Product Control. You will collaborate with multiple stakeholders and ensure BAU requirements are satisfied, especially during critical delivery milestones.
The position requires extensive experience in finance and project management, with strong proficiency in stakeholder engagement and control frameworks. Preferred candidates will hold relevant professional certifications.
